Decatur's landscape is unique, and that matters when you're choosing turf. The DeKalb red clay underlying most properties here drains poorly—it's why so many yards have chronic moisture issues and why natural grass often struggles. The mature tree canopy that makes Decatur so beautiful creates deep shade zones that natural turf simply can't tolerate. Neighborhoods like Oakhurst and Winnona Park feature properties with significant elevation changes and root competition from established oaks and pines, making traditional lawn care a constant battle. Commercial artificial turf is engineered to work in these exact conditions. Modern synthetic systems drain efficiently through engineered bases that account for clay-heavy soils, so standing water and root rot aren't concerns. The turf itself is UV-stabilized to handle both the intense afternoon sun on south-facing exposures and the persistent shade under mature trees—performance is consistent across both microclimates. Installation in Decatur typically requires grading and subbase prep to manage that red clay, but once set, your turf is maintenance-free and won't degrade from Georgia's humidity or temperature swings. We install engineered drainage systems beneath the turf that route water away from that problematic DeKalb clay. Instead of water sitting and causing root rot, it moves through the base layer and disperses properly. This is especially critical in Oakhurst and Winnona Park, where clay saturation is common. The result is a dry, usable surface even during heavy Georgia rains, and no more mud or soggy patches.
